How do I Use Geo-pinned Portals for Local Business Discovery?
To effectively use geo-pinned portals for local business discovery, we implement a strategy that anchors your digital presence to precise physical coordinates. This approach moves beyond traditional listings by creating map-native properties designed for AI-driven local SEO.
Here are the key steps to leveraging this technology for your business:
- Implement Keyword Staking: We assign geographical weighting to high-intent terms (like “dentist in Miami”) and deploy them onto global AI maps to secure ordered placement in map-native search interfaces.
- Optimize for Lead Capture: Use portals that include integrated conversion tools such as instant click-to-call buttons, pre-populated contact forms, and appointment scheduling widgets directly within the map layer.
- Establish Web3 Digital Identity: Utilize on-chain brand anchoring to create a tamper-proof, verifiable record of your business name and location, building trust through cryptographic assurance.
- Maintain Technical SEO Foundations: Ensure NAP consistency (Name, Address, Phone) across all portals and implement schema markup to provide search engines with explicit signals regarding your service area and physical location.
- Integrate with Content Strategies: We use AI to generate localized, long-form content that reinforces your staked keywords, which is then internally linked to your geo-pinned portals to funnel authority.
